ACHARYA NAGARJUNA UNIVERSITY

B.A / B.Sc / B.Com / B.C.A DEGREE EXAMINATION


MODEL PAPER
First Year – Second Semester Time: 2 Hours
Paper: Information & Communication Technology – 1 Maximum: 50 Marks

I. Answer all the multiple choice questions 10 X 1 = 10 M

1. IC stands for
a) Information Circuit c) Integrated Circuit
b) Intelligent Circuit d) Internal Circuit
2. The brain of the computer is_______________
a) Control Unit c) ALU
b) CPU d) All of the above
3. The optical devices among the following are:
a) MICR c) Barcode reader
b) Scanner d) All of these
4. Magnetic tapes, floppy disks, optical disks, flash memory, and hard disks are examples
of_________________
a) Primary Memory c) Auxiliary Memory
b) Cache Memory d) Flash Memory
5. Deleted items stored in _________________
a) Recycle bin c) file
b) Folder d) None of these
6. Shortcut for open a new document is_______________
a) Ctrl+S c) Ctrl+P
b) Ctrl+H d) Ctrl+O
7. Ctrl+Z is used for________________
a) Undo the last action c) Redo the last action
b) Add a new page d) Paste the content from clipboard
8. To insert a hyperlink in a slide ___________________
a) Choose Insert Hyperlink c) Press Ctrl+K
b) Hyperlink can’t be inserted in slides d) Both a & c
9. Where a row and column meet, what do you call that?
a) A Cell c) A Block
b) A Box d) None of these
10. Clear the contents by pressing “DELETE” key from a keyboard will clear_______ in excel
a) Text only c) Format only
b) Comments only d) Both the Text & Format
II. Mach the Fallowing 5X1=5M

1. Microsoft ( ) Icon
2. Plotter ( ) Menu
3. Desktop ( ) PowerPoint Presentation
4. Help ( ) Auditing
5. Excel ( ) Output Devices

III. Answer Any Five Questions from the fallowing 5 X 7 = 35 M

11. Explain the block diagram of computers?


12. Explain about printers?
13. What are magnetic storage devices and explain.
14. What are different types of operating systems?
15. Draw a neat diagram and explain different parts of word window.
16. Explain mail merge.
17. How to create save and print a new presentation.
18. Explain some functions in excel.
